Description: Sugarcane lodging is a common issue, however, reliable methods of quantifying the degree of lodging have not been developed. The ability to assess the extent of lodging in the field using digital image processing techniques will lead to the implementation of many precision agriculture techniques, such as lodging maps to further the assessment of spatial variability within a cropping system. Images of lodged sugarcane in the field were acquired from various directions by installing camera at different locations of harvester, tractor and wagon. High resolution color camera was used to capture the lodged sugarcane images. These acquired sugarcane images were processed using various image processing techniques such as image segmentation, summing up binary pixels, texture analysis, edge detection, and vertical and horizontal edge pixel measurement to develop a robust image processing algorithm in order to detect and quantify lodging. Among different image processing approach presented in this study the vertical edge signature data showed works effectively. The relationship of vertical edge direction feature with degree of rotation for the upright green cane, lodged green and burnt sugarcane shown clear separation among them. The percent analysis in terms of pixel count of different type of sugarcane condition under various category of lodging were also observed. Upright green cane examples show much greater percentage of erect stems (on average 45%) and less amount of recumbent cane (on average 24%). Whereas for both condition of lodged cane the greater percentage of stem fall into recumbent category about on average 42%.
